Side-by-Side Nutrition Facts

Nutrient Hummus Maple Syrup Better
Calories 166kcal 260kcal Hummus
Protein 7.9g 0g Hummus
Total Fat 9.6g 0.1g Maple Syrup
Carbohydrates 14.3g 67g Maple Syrup
Fiber 6g 0g Hummus
Sugar 0.3g 60.5g Hummus
Vitamin C 0mg 0mg Tie
Calcium 38mg 102mg Maple Syrup
Iron 2.4mg 0.1mg Hummus
Potassium 228mg 212mg Hummus

Hummus vs Maple Syrup — Key Takeaway

Hummus has 94 fewer calories per 100g than Maple Syrup, making it the lighter option. For protein, Hummus leads with 7.9g per 100g. Hummus is the better source of fiber at 6g per 100g.
